The The Happy Planner™ 12 Month Box Kit – Best Days contains the following:


12 Months non-dated Monthly & Weekly Pages

I’m kinda half-and-half about this non-dated thing. Perhaps because I was too excited that I must’ve overlooked that tiny detail. It’s good if you’re excellent in calligraphy, have a beautiful handwriting or you have those date stamps (I’m referring to the acrylic ones). But for me, my handwriting sucks so this can be a problem. Nevertheless, I still kinda like it because it allows me to be more creative. Besides, I can still buy those stamps if I want to. Hehe.

However, you will also be given 12 sets of number/daily stickers (1-31) then 2 sets of your monthly stickers, one for your dividers/tabs then one for your monthly sheets. Still, with regard to the daily stickers, you’re still going to end up writing the dates either on your monthly or weekly pages. Depending on how you use it.

As for the paper, I like how thick they are. Sure, there may be some bleeding when using marker-type pens, but when just using my Coleto or my Uni pens, the paper’s fine. Each month also rotate up to four colors all throughout the entire planner, and you can see these colors from the divider (which I will get to later) up to the pages. This can be a bit hard especially if you decorate your planner like me because sometimes the theme doesn’t really match your decoration so you end up covering majority of the page. Especially with this new planner, the weekend boxes are fully colored so I end up covering all of them if I have a let’s say pink-colored theme in my weekly spread, and the current month is colored teal.

They also changed the layout a bit. They transferred the “Morning”, “Afternoon” and “Evening” category at the left side of each page, requiring an extra washi tape in order to cover it up. lol.

But don’t get me wrong, I’m still in love with this planner. Like I said, I decorate this planner, so these cons are easy to fix.


12 Months non-dated Dividers

As mentioned, the dividers’ tabs are non-dated so one of the sticker’s monthly set will go here. I love these dividers. They’re filled with inspirational quotes and their background images are also beautiful. They’re not pixelated and the print’s quality is amazing. I find myself staring at them from time to time.

4 Sheets of Stickers

These stickers, as mentioned, includes the dates and months that will help you with your planner, along with some extras such as birthdays, note to self, reminder stickers. Basically some stuff that you need to give your planner a bit of pizzazz.

Notes & Pocket Folder

Where you can place your receipts, stickers, post it notes, rulers, etc. I personally put my basic stickers here and then a ruler to cut my washi tapes.

At the very last page, you also have a ruled page allowing you to jot down some important stuff


5 Sticky Note Pads & 3 Magnetic Book Marks

The Sticky Note Pads contain 20 sheets each and they fit right in to the weekly boxes. They’re really pretty and they’re also a bit thick. They’re sticky enough so they can stick in place to your planner but they’re not too sticker that you’ll end up ruining either your sticky notes or your page.

The magnets are pretty. One’s a black & white heart, one’s an arrow that says “Right Now” and one’s a pink floral flag. I love all of them but I place them as more of an accent. I don’t use them as a bookmark. hehe.

What I also love about The Happy Planner is that it’s disc-bound therefore you can fully customize it to your heart’s content. These discs are also removable and you can buy bigger discs at the MAMBI website if you would like to expand your planner. MAMBI sells “extension packs” (fitness, recipe, wedding, etc) so you can combine them to your existing Happy Planner. Just buy bigger discs then you’re good to go.

You can add/remove pages just like I mentioned before. So if you decorate your pages like me, you can take them off then put it back on when you’re done. You can add some journal cards, dashboards, etc. I personally use a one-hole punch then cut some slits so i can add bookmarks, project life cards. You can also buy the Lavenger Portable Punch at Amazon if you want. I’m planning to buy that one. Hehehe.

The covers are removable as well so you can totally make your own cover, print and laminate it, so you make your planner a bit more personalized.
